When starting a house remodel or brand-new building job, you will most likely work with a basic specialist. A general professional is an expert that is qualified to take a set of building strategies and create them as detailed. The basic specialist may assist perform the day-to-day building, or they may just hire employees as well as supervise all the job tasks. In either case, the job of the basic contractor is to see that your job gets constructed.
A business contractor gives similar services as a property basic professional but concentrates on collaborating with massive jobs for businesses, institutions, nonprofits, governments and also growth firms. When researching commercial general specialists, review their portfolio of job and also validate they have enough experience working in the location you require. Residental general professionals are seasoned specialists on residence improvement. They collaborate with you to conceptualize your job at a high degree, consisting of style and job timeline. They work with subcontractors to achieve specific tasks at the right stages of construction. The same building market knowledge that aids GCs source the ideal subcontractors likewise helps them impose top quality job.

When working with a smaller general professional, figure out https://b3.zcubes.com/v.aspx?mid=7146443&title=home-remodeling--improvement-suggestions how much experience the head guy has. If the candidate you're thinking of hiring is a carpenter who's just branching off and trying his hand at being a carpenter-contractor, believe very carefully prior to making the employing choice. He might understand his profession quickly, but the reality is it's really a new profession, one that needs less structure skills and also even more organization feeling. If your remodeling task is moderate in extent, employing a rookie GC might work to your benefit, considering that many people starting on a brand-new career have a satisfaction in achievement that fades over time. Ensure you are confident he has the scheduling, budgeting, as well as other skills to take care of the broadened responsibilities.

In the USA, there are no Federal licensing needs to end up being a general contractor, although many states call for general professionals to get a regional certificate to operate. Some general contractors obtain bachelor's degrees in building and construction scientific research, constructing science, checking, building safety, or other self-controls.
